What is the total cost for attending the Festival Gathering?
We have tried to keep the total cost for the four days—room, food, and registration—at about $500, not including travel.
What is the cost of registration?
MEMBER: If you are a member and register before the May 11, 2012 early deadline, registration is $259. After the deadline member registration is $359.
STUDENT: If you are a full-time student (no matter what your age), registration is $129 before the May 11 deadline, $179 after the deadline. You are not required to be a member to get this discount.
COMMUTER: If you stay for all 4 days, there is an additional $25 commuter fee payable to NBS for use of the Ridgecrest facility.
ONE DAY: The one-day rate of $129 before May 11, $159 after, includes the commuter fee that will be paid to Ridgecrest. You do not need to be a member to receive the one-day rate.

What does registration include?
Your registration fee allows you to attend all workshops, plenary sessions, storytelling sessions, morning worship, and evening entertainment; in addition to any and all materials that are handed out on site. It does not include food or lodging.
Do I have to be a member to attend?
No, you may register as a non-member, but it is less expensive to become a member and get the discount, plus you will get all the membership benefits, including the newsletter. We want you to be a member! Membership categories that make you eligible for the discount are:
Standard - $75; Family - $100 (all family members receive discount); Basic (over 65) - $40; Institution - $200 (multiple members of church all receive the discount).
